Japanese Maple pruning services involve carefully trimming and shaping these ornamental trees to maintain their health and aesthetic appeal. Skilled service providers evaluate the tree’s structure, removing dead or diseased branches and reducing excessive growth. Proper pruning encourages better airflow within the canopy, which can help prevent common issues like mold or pest infestations. Regular pruning also helps preserve the distinctive, delicate appearance of Japanese Maples, ensuring they remain a beautiful focal point in a yard or garden.

This service can address several common problems that arise with Japanese Maples. Overgrown branches may cause the tree to become unbalanced or develop weak points that are prone to breaking during storms or high winds. Crowded canopies can lead to poor air circulation, increasing the risk of fungal diseases. Additionally, improper growth patterns or damaged limbs can hinder the tree’s overall health and longevity. Professional pruning helps resolve these issues by promoting stronger, healthier growth and reducing the risk of future problems.

The overview below groups typical Japanese Maple Pruning proj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Chico, CA.

In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.

Smaller Pruning Jobs - Local contractors typically charge between $100 and $300 for routine pruning of Japanese Maples, which includes shaping and minor cleanup. Many standard maintenance projects fall within this range, especially for mature trees requiring minimal work.

Moderate Trimming and Shaping - For more extensive pruning, such as thinning or structural shaping, costs generally range from $300 to $600. These projects are common for homeowners seeking to improve tree health and appearance without major interventions.

Large or Complex Pruning - Larger jobs involving significant canopy reduction or removal can cost from $600 to $1,200, with some intricate projects reaching higher prices. Fewer projects fall into this tier, typically involving older or larger trees requiring specialized equipment.

Full Tree Removal - Complete removal of a Japanese Maple can range from $1,000 to over $3,000, depending on size and accessibility. Such projects are less frequent but may be necessary for safety or landscape redesign purposes.

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

Why is pruning important for Japanese Maples? Proper pruning helps maintain the tree's shape, encourages healthy growth, and can improve its overall appearance and vigor.

When is the best time to prune a Japanese Maple? The ideal time for pruning is typically during late winter or early spring before new growth begins, but local contractors can advise based on specific conditions.

What pruning techniques are used for Japanese Maples? Techniques include thinning, heading, and shaping to remove dead or diseased branches and to promote balanced growth and aesthetic form.

Can pruning help prevent disease in Japanese Maples? Yes, removing damaged or overcrowded branches can improve air circulation and reduce the risk of disease and pest issues.

How do local contractors ensure the health of my Japanese Maple during pruning? Experienced service providers use careful pruning practices to avoid stress and damage, supporting the tree’s long-term health and beauty.
